What is ACH Agreement

The ACH Origination Agreement is a service agreement used by companies and financial institutions to facilitate ACH services for initiating credit and debit entries.

What is the ACH Origination Agreement?

The ACH Origination Agreement is a critical contract that defines the relationship between a company and a financial institution, specifically Bloomfield State Bank. This agreement serves to facilitate ACH services, which include essential functionalities for initiating credit and debit transactions. It encompasses the roles of the involved parties, clarifying their responsibilities and the purpose of the agreement within the context of ACH services.
Understanding the ACH origination agreement is vital for businesses engaging in electronic financial transactions. By laying out the terms of service clearly, it ensures that both the company and the financial institution are aligned in their operations, mitigating risks and fostering trust in ACH services.

Both the Company and the Financial Institution are required to sign the ACH Origination Agreement to ensure both parties are bound by the terms outlined in the document.
You will need to provide details such as company and financial institution names, dates, EIN numbers, and any specific authorizations necessary for ACH processing.
While there may not be a strict deadline, it is advisable to complete and submit the ACH Origination Agreement promptly to ensure timely initiation of ACH services.
Yes, the ACH Origination Agreement can be completed online using pdfFiller. You can fill out the fields electronically, review the content, and save or submit it directly from the platform.
Common mistakes include leaving required fields blank, misspelling names, and failing to ensure both parties sign the agreement. Review the document carefully before submission.
If amendments are necessary after signing, it is recommended to create an amendment or a new agreement that reflects the updated terms, ensuring both parties re-sign the document.
No, notarization is not required for the ACH Origination Agreement, but both parties must sign it to validate the contract.
